Arab Weather - Sinan Khalaf - The latest lightning radar images capture multiple lightning signals in the northern parts of the Hail region. Satellite images also show a heavy presence of thunderstorm clouds in those areas, which are exposed to extremely heavy rainfall, as a result of the region being affected by a state of atmospheric instability.

Satellite images also show the formation of large amounts of cumulonimbus clouds in the skies of the southern parts of the Red Sea, accompanied by varying amounts of rain.
